logaritmi con turbo pascal
turbologa.htm

note ed esempi a integrazione


quoziente di logaritmi
(se in formato misto, prima trasformarli)
program mistoquo;
(*  quoziente tra logaritmi *)
uses crt;
var l1,l2,l1f,l2f,quoziente:real;


procedure pausa;
var ch:char;
begin
writeln('premi return');
ch:=readkey;
end;

begin
clrscr;
writeln('logaritmi da elaborare, formato misto');
writeln('l1 = <1>.32475  misto, trasformo -1 + 0.32475 = -0.67525 ');
writeln('l2 = <2>.59736  misto, trasformo -2 + 0.59736 = -1.40264');
writeln('quoziente = l1 / l2 = - 0.67525 / -1.40264');
writeln('........................................');
writeln('l1 = <1>.32475 misto ');
l1f:=-0.67525;
writeln('l1f trasformato =',l1f:2:6);
writeln('l2 = <2>.59736 misto');
l2f:=-1.40264;
writeln('l2f trasformato =',l2f:2:6);
writeln('.............................');
writeln('eseguo quoziente = l1f/l2f ');
quoziente:=l1f/l2f;
writeln('quoziente   = ',quoziente:2:6);
writeln('...........................');
pausa;
end.



prodotto di logaritmi
(se in formato misto, prima trasformarli

program mistopro;
(*  prodotto tra logaritmi *)
uses crt;
var l1,l2,l1f,l2f,prodotto:real;


procedure pausa;
var ch:char;
begin
writeln('premi return');
ch:=readkey;
end;

begin
clrscr;
writeln('logaritmi da elaborare, formato misto');
writeln('........................................');
writeln('l1 = <1>.32475 misto ');
l1f:=-0.67525;
writeln('l1f trasformato =',l1f:2:6);
writeln('l2 = <2>.59736 misto');
l2f:=-1.40264;
writeln('l2f trasformato =',l2f:2:6);
writeln('.............................');
writeln('eseguo prodotto = l1f*l2f ');
prodotto:=l1f*l2f;
writeln('prodotto   = ',prodotto:2:6);
writeln('...........................');
pausa;
end.


turbo33.htm